Accurately diagnosing cancer can take weeks or months. WebCells are the very small units that make up all living things, including the human body. There are billions of cells in each person's body. Cancer happens when cells that are not normal grow and spread very fast. Normal body cells grow and divide and know to stop growing. Over time, they also die. how many calories in jatz

Following cancer screening recommendations affects cancer outcomes. WebOct 26, 2024 · There's no proven way to prevent mouth cancer. However, you can reduce your risk of mouth cancer if you: Stop using tobacco or don't start. If you use tobacco, stop. If you don't use tobacco, don't start. Using tobacco, whether smoked or chewed, exposes the cells in your mouth to dangerous cancer-causing chemicals.

WebDec 6, 2024 · Merkel cell carcinoma. Merkel cell carcinoma causes firm, shiny nodules that occur on or just beneath the skin and in hair follicles. Merkel cell carcinoma is most often found on the head, neck and trunk. Sebaceous gland carcinoma. This uncommon and aggressive cancer originates in the oil glands in the skin. WebOct 15, 2015 · That's the thinking behind new research into elephants and naked mole rats, which scientists are hoping could point the way towards better treatments in humans. The root cause of cancer is a chance mutation in a group of cells, which is why it's puzzling that elephants get cancer so rarely - they have 100 times the number of cells us humans do ...

WebOct 26, 2024 · Vary your diet to include lots of fruits and vegetables as well as whole grains. The American Cancer Society recommends that cancer survivors: Eat at least 2.5 to 3 cups of vegetables and 1.5 to 2 cups of fruits every day. Choose healthy fats, including omega-3 fatty acids, such as those found in fish and walnuts.
